http://duoduokou.com/csharp/62073751838227125739.html Web,c#,parameters,pass-by-reference,pass-by-value,C#,Parameters,Pass By Reference,Pass By Value,我知道,如果我将值类型(int,struct等)作为参数传递(没有ref关键字),该变量的副本将传递给方法,但如果我使用ref关键字,则传递对该变量的引用,而不是新的引用 但是对于引用类型 ...
通过引用传递:多个接口的孩子 - IT宝库
WebC# Pass By Reference (Ref) with Examples In c#, passing a value type parameter to a method by reference means passing a reference of the variable to the method. So the … WebMay 5, 2014 · C# compiles the anonymous expressions in runtime. If you try to send a ref to your closured code, then the compiler has to find a way to reach out your ref object which doesn't make sense. Here you can check the closures: http://en.wikipedia.org/wiki/Closure_ (computer_science) Share Improve this answer Follow edited May 5, 2014 at 16:08 petco guilford ct hours
Pass Int by Reference in C# Techie Delight
WebNov 16, 2011 · Parameters are passed by value in C# unless they are marked with the ref or out modifiers. For reference types, this means that the reference is passed by value. Therefore, in Fuss, l is referring to the same instance of List as its caller. Therefore, any modifications to this instance of List will be seen by the caller. Web我是C 的新手 來自PHP ,但令我感到震驚的是,通過遍歷列表,我無法傳遞對該變量的引用,即以下代碼無效: 我研究了一下, 發現了創建 可更新的枚舉數 的建議,但我不知道該怎么做。 我遵循了一個示例,嘗試為IEnumerator.Current方法和我的自定義枚舉器 PeopleEnum.Curre WebApr 10, 2024 · But it seems that every time I create a block instance, one of the values that I pass into the constructor seems to be passing by reference rather than value. So, when I modify the variable -which is a List of enums representing the direction that each face of the block is facing- the lists in each of the block objects changes too. starchamber products